Output 90ac586d76ae920fe4b9e0583305beae3de1bd7dd536770b83f264bceba5bb21:0

value
148550233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9174169322bc02bc9a836441fc3dd01f36d657f7 OP_EQUAL
address
MMAFHCCeBccAbVPPv8V2huyUj8avvwuitB
transaction
90ac586d76ae920fe4b9e0583305beae3de1bd7dd536770b83f264bceba5bb21
spent
true